Eslint-plugin-prettier version 2.5.0 introduces a notable update compared to version 2.4.0, primarily revolving around its development dependencies. The key change lies in the upgrade of the Prettier dependency, moving from version 1.6.1 to version 1.10.2. This is significant for developers as it brings in the latest formatting rules and capabilities offered by Prettier, ensuring code adheres to the most current standards. This update allows developers to leverage new Prettier features and benefit from improved code formatting accuracy and efficiency.
While other development dependencies remain largely consistent like mocha, eslint, moment, semver, eslint-plugin-node, eslint-plugin-self, eslint-config-prettier, eslint-plugin-eslint-plugin and eslint-config-not-an-aardvark, the core formatting engine used by eslint-plugin-prettier gets a significant boost. For users, this means access to the newest Prettier formatting options directly within their ESLint workflow without requiring any manual updates or configuration changes to prettier itself. Consequently, developers can seamlessly integrate the newest Prettier features, thus benefitting from the constant improved code formatting and styling enhancements offered by the integration between the two tools. The package license, repository, author, core dependencies for diffing, and peer dependency for Prettier versions remain the same across both versions.
The are not vulnerabilities for the version 2.5.0 of the package eslint-plugin-prettier